Johnstown is located in Pennsylvania, United States, at GPS coordinates 40.32674, -78.92197. It falls within the America/New_York timezone. This city is known for its rich industrial history, particularly in steel production, and it played a significant role during the American Industrial Revolution.
Johnstown is also recognized for its tragic history involving the Johnstown Flood of 1889, which resulted in significant loss of life and property. Today, it has transformed into a center for culture and education, with institutions like the Johnstown Area Heritage Association working to preserve its history. The city’s regional significance lies in its efforts to revitalize and promote local heritage while adapting to modern economic challenges.
Johnstown is in the Eastern Time Zone, specifically America/New_York, which has a UTC offset of -5 hours during standard time. This means that when it is noon in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), it is 7 AM in Johnstown. During daylight saving time, which begins on the second Sunday in March and ends on the first Sunday in November, the offset shifts to UTC -4 hours.
This means that from March to November, local time in Johnstown is one hour ahead of standard time. Johnstown, located in Pennsylvania, is known for its rich industrial history and notable events, particularly the Great Johnstown Flood of 1889. The Johnstown Flood National Memorial commemorates this disaster, offering visitors insights into the events that shaped the community. The city is also home to the Johnstown Area Heritage Association, which preserves the local history and culture through various exhibits and programs.
In addition to its historical significance, Johnstown showcases natural beauty, especially with its picturesque hills and rivers. The city has several parks, including the scenic Point Stadium, which serves as a venue for local sports events and community gatherings. The area hosts various cultural events throughout the year, reflecting its diverse heritage, including the annual Johnstown FolkFest, celebrating music and arts.

Johnstown is accessible via the John Murtha Johnstown-Cambria County Airport, which offers limited flights. For broader access, consider flying into Pittsburgh International Airport and renting a car for the scenic two-hour drive. Amtrak provides train service to nearby locations, while Greyhound and local bus services connect Johnstown to other cities in Pennsylvania.
Johnstown experiences a humid continental climate, with cold winters and warm summers. Average summer temperatures range from 70 to 85 degrees Fahrenheit, while winter temperatures can drop to the 20s. The best time to visit is during late spring and early fall when the weather is mild and the scenery is picturesque, especially with fall foliage.
